Shimla is the capital of the northern Indian state of Himachal Pradesh, in the Himalayan foothills. Once the summer capital of British India, it remains the terminus of the narrow-gauge Kalka-Shimla Railway, completed in 1903. It’s also known for the handicraft shops that line The Mall, a pedestrian avenue, as well as the Lakkar Bazaar, a market specializing in wooden toys and crafts. Morning after breakfast check out the hotel and proceed drive to Sarahan via Rampur, Sarahan famous for Shri Bhim Akali Temple situated at 2150 mtrs dedicated to the mother goddess Bhimakali presiding deity of the Rulers of former Bushahr Sate. After visiting the temple you can go the nearest town of Rampur Bushehr situated at 33 kms. A small township situated at 1,005 meters on the left bank of the Sutlej, serves as Bushahar’s winter capital. This township is well connected with major trading routes that joined Indian markets with Central Asia and Tibet. Also it is buzzed with mercantile activity, especially in November during the Lavi fair. Later in the evening come back to hotel for overnight stay.

Today After morning Breakfast then , check-out from the Hotel & drive to Nako. Enroute visit Kalpa – The District Headquarter of Kinnar. Kalpa was known as Chini back in the days when it was the Regional Capital. Kalpa has changed little in the last 500 years. Each & every corner of Kalpa facing Jorkanden& the Kinner Kailash Peaks, considered as one of the mythical homes of Lord Shiva & by its side is a 79 foot rock formation that resembles a Shiv linga that changes its colour as the day passes & is visible to the naked eye on a clear day. In evening visit Buddhist Gompa – Hu Bu Lan Kar. Arrive in Nako, check into the hotel and enjoy dinner & Overnight stay at the hotel.
Today morning you can tour the village around and can also head on towards Tabo Monastery constructed in 996 AD; – Not just in Spiti but in the whole of the Tibetan Buddhist world it has very wonderful Chogs – Khor [‘Doctrinal Circle’ or ‘Doctrinal Enclave’]. This complex holds 9 Temples, 23 Chortens, a Monk’s Chamber & Nun’s Chamber. The monastery contains large number of Scriptures & Pieces of Art, Wall Painting & Stucco. After reaching Tabo check in at the hotel, post lunch you can visit the famous Dhankar Monastery, the traditional Capital of Spiti sits prettily on a hilltop. Today, more than 160 Lamas reside here. A Statue of Dhyan Buddha where four complete figures of Buddha sit back to back is the main attraction of this more than 7TH Century old Monastery. On the way back you can visit the pin valley the only cold desert in Himachal pradesh. Dinner & Overnight stay at the hotel.
After breakfast start your journey towards kaza, and check in at the hotel, post lunch you can visit Ki Monastery which is believed to be built by Dromton (1008 - 64 AD). Thereafter we’ll head on for Kibber Village and Kibber Sanctuary where you can spot Blue Sheep and Ibex. Our last spot will be Komic Village which is the highest village in Asia, located at a height of 18,000 feet above sea level. The beauty of this place cannot be described in words; it can only be felt and experienced with naked eyes. After such spectacular sightseeing come back to kaza for overnight stay at the hotel. Today morning after breakfast proceed towards Kunzum pass. Kunzum Pass is one of the highest motorable passes across the Kunzum range at an altitude of 4551 m. It serves as the entrance pass to Spiti valley from Lahaul. Goddess Kunjum (Durga/Parvati) resides in a temple on the Kunzum top and keeps guard over the pass and wards of the evil.
